West Allis (CBS 58)--Three strikes but not down and out for me. This is my third year in the Celebrity Cream Puff Eating Competition and still no blue ribbon. However, I was quite pleased with my effort. I ate just about everything. But just not fast enough. I competed against nine others. In the end, the winner was radio producer, Dave Michaels from 97.3. He did put cotton balls up his nose to avoid having the cream end up there.
Just a quick note. On Saturday at noon, Joey Chestnut will be at the State Fair taking part in a cheese curd eating competition. He normally devours a lot of hot dogs on July 4th. But this time, it's all about the Wisconsin cheese.
